It can be seen clearly from the two pictures that as superficial air velocity goes up, bubble number and size increase. Since
U=0.081 m/s, the fluidized bed is filled with ascending air flow and the fluidized bed density can be adjusted by different
superficial air velocities (from 0.081 m/s to 0.119 m/s). After the superficial air velocity of 0.119 m/s, the solid particles performs
serious back-mixing and fluidized bed is full of large bubbles, indicating the fluidized bed became invalid for coal separation.
